1: Hygiene First! - Wash your hands with a mild soap that doesn't contain moisturizers and dry them completely with a clean, lint free towel prior to handling your contact lenses.
2: Use Fresh Solution! - Using old solution or topping off the solution can create an environment that is filled with bacteria.
3: Don't Forget The Case! - After removing your GP lenses from the case, be certain to rinse it with hot tap water and allow it to air dry. Cases should be replaced every month.
4: Read Instructions! - Be sure to carefully follow the directions provided by your contact lens professional because every care system has different instructions.
5: Keep In Touch! - GP contact lens wear is extremely safe, but if you notice any redness, mucous, mattering or if you experience pain or change in your vision remove your contact lenses and call your contact lens professional's office immediately.
6: Avoid Confusion! - To avoid mixing up your contact lenses, get into a routine and always start with the same lens when you apply, remove or care for them.
